Local tips
- Visit during the early morning or late afternoon for the best wildlife spotting opportunities.
- Bring a pair of binoculars for birdwatching, as the area is home to numerous bird species.
- Pack light but include essentials like sunscreen, water, and a camera to capture the stunning scenery.
- Check local guides for any cultural events or festivals happening during your visit.
- Respect wildlife and maintain a safe distance, especially when observing animals in their natural habitat.

Public Transportation
For those using public transportation, take a bus from your nearest bus station to Kampala. The journey from the Eastern Region to Kampala typically takes around 3-4 hours. Once in Kampala, you can take a taxi or a boda-boda (motorcycle taxi) to reach Swift Camp. Make sure to communicate your destination clearly to the driver, mentioning the coordinates (0.294004, 32.591001) if necessary. Public transport may incur costs around UGX 20,000 to 30,000 for the bus and UGX 10,000 to 20,000 for the taxi.
-
Boda-Boda
Once you arrive in Kampala, you may also consider hiring a boda-boda to Swift Camp. This is a fast and efficient way to navigate through the city. Be sure to negotiate the fare before starting your ride, which should generally range from UGX 10,000 to 15,000 depending on your starting point in Kampala.
